LinqExtensionsIn Method (NullableGuid, IEnumerable)

Returns true if list contains the specified id. Primarily intended for use inside IQueryable/IEnumerable queries

Namespace:  Aloe.SystemFrameworks.Domain.LINQ
Assembly:  Aloe.SystemFrameworks.Domain (in Aloe.SystemFrameworks.Domain.dll) Version: 20.1.3.5
Syntax
public static bool In(
	this Nullable<Guid> id,
	IEnumerable list
)

Parameters

id
Type: SystemNullableGuid
The id to search for.
list
Type: System.CollectionsIEnumerable
The list in which to search for the id.

Return Value

Type: Boolean
true if the list contains the id

Remarks
.In is recognized by the domain objects query translator and is optimally executed as an efficient data source command.
